Reporting Database
The reporting database is a propietary binary database that contains historical metrics about mail flow for the
appliance.
Caution: This command will delete all reporting data and cannot be reverted.
From the CLI, use diagnostic > reporting > deletedb to clear the Reporting database. No commit is necessary.
myesa.local> diagnostic
Choose the operation you want to perform:
− RAID − Disk Verify Utility.
− DISK_USAGE − Check Disk Usage.
− NETWORK − Network Utilities.
− REPORTING − Reporting Utilities.
− TRACKING − Tracking Utilities.
− RELOAD − Reset configuration to the initial manufacturer values.
[]> reporting
The reporting system is currently enabled.
Choose the operation you want to perform:
− DELETEDB − Reinitialize the reporting database.
− DISABLE − Disable the reporting system.
[]> deletedb
This command will delete all reporting data and cannot be aborted. In some instances
it may take several minutes to complete. Please do not attempt a system restart
until the command has returned. Are you sure you
want to continue? [N]> y
Shutting down reporting system......
Removing all reporting data. This may take several minutes.
The reporting system database has been reinitialized.
The reporting system is currently enabled.
